Molecular Detection of Sugarcane Ratoon Stunting Disease in Sugarcane Producing Areas of China

  • In order to clarify the occurrence of sugarcane ratoon stunting disease(RSD) in sugarcane plantations in China, 598 sugarcane leaf samples were collected from 12 sugarcane plantations in the main sugarcane producing areas like Guangxi, Yunnan, Guangdong and Hainan in China, and the pathogen of RSD was identified by using specific primers through polymerase chain reaction(PCR). The results showed that 99 out of 598 sugarcane samples were detected to contain bacteria of RSD, with an average detection rate of 16.56%. RSD detection rates varied in 12 sugarcane plantations, the highest in Lincang sugarcane plantations(27.78%) and the lowest in Nanning sugarcane plantations(4.88%). RSD was detected in 15 main sugarcane cultivars, with positive detection rates ranging from 15.38% to 44.44%. Among the sugarcane cultivars, sugarcane cultivar ROC 22 was most seriously infected with RSD, and its RSD positive detection rate was 44.44%, while sugarcane cultivar Haitang 22 was less infected with RSD and its RSD positive detection rate was 15.38%. It can be seen that sugarcane ratoon stunting disease is common in sugarcane cultivars in China.
